Comparing Vermont, United States with Leesburg, Virginia

Compare Climate information for Vermont, United States and Leesburg, Virginia

Is Vermont, United States warmer or hotter than Leesburg, Virginia?

On average across the year, no, Vermont, United States is not hotter than Leesburg, Virginia . Vermont, United States has an average temperature of 5°C/41°F and Leesburg, Virginia has an average temperature of 14°C/57°F.

Vermont, United States's hottest month is July, with an average maximum temperature of 24°C/75°F, which is not hotter than Leesburg, Virginia's hottest month (also July, with an average maximum temperature of 32°C/90°F).

Is Vermont, United States colder or cooler than Leesburg, Virginia?

On average across the year, yes, Vermont, United States is colder than Leesburg, Virginia . Vermont, United States has an average minimum temperature of 0°C/32°F and Leesburg, Virginia has an average minimum temperature of 8°C/46°F.



Vermont, United States's coldest month is January, with an average minimum temperature of -13°C/9°F, which is colder than Leesburg, Virginia's coldest month (also January, with an average minimum temperature of -4°C/25°F).

Does Vermont, United States have more rain than Leesburg, Virginia?

On average across the year, yes, Vermont, United States has more rain than Leesburg, Virginia. Vermont, United States has an average annual rainfall of 1409mm and Leesburg, Virginia has an average annual rainfall of 1221mm.

Vermont, United States's wettest month is June, with an average monthly rainfall of 174mm, which is wetter than Leesburg, Virginia's wettest month (May, with an average monthly rainfall of 138mm).
